TZx Commuters: Bring Your Bike on the Bus

July 29, 2008

The Tappan Zee Express has always made it easy to get from Rockland to the Metro North stations in Tarrytown and White Plains — if you have a short walk or easy drive to the bus stop. Now, there’s another way to connect with the TZx: ride your bike to the bus.

Beginning August 1, the TZx Bike-On-Bus Service will connect Rockland commuters to the Tarrytown train and Westchester county. Bikers can place their cycles in the luggage compartments of TZx buses on a “first come first serve” basis.

The TZx route serves takes customers to and from many biking destinations including the Old Croton Aqueduct, the Bronx River Pathway, New York State Bike Route 9, as well as commuter rail stations in Suffern, Spring Valley, Tarrytown, and White Plains.

Source: Rockland Dept of Transportation, Mid-Hudson Bike/Pedestrian Master Plan, Rockland Bike Club
